We could evaluate the wavelengths of light which might be absorbed by a material using a UV spectrometer. The spectrometer creates a graph of absorbance versus wavelength. The wavelength, over the x axis, is usually calculated in nanometers. The absorbance, to the y axis, is frequently dimensionless; that's mainly because it's a portion. It's the ratio of exactly how check here much mild is absorbed through the sample when compared with the amount of was absorbed by some reference, anything to which we Assess the sample.
